One cannot discuss the Harry Potter audiobooks without addressing the unique situation regarding their narration. Unlike many books with a single definitive voice, the Harry Potter series is defined by two vastly different, yet equally celebrated, narrators: Jim Dale and Stephen Fry. Jim Dale (The US Editions) For American audiences, Jim Dale is the voice of Harry Potter. His narration, produced by Listening Library (an imprint of Penguin Random House), is nothing short of a theatrical production.
